Historical Context of Technological Evolution

In examining the trajectory of human technology, one must consider the critical junctures that catalyzed transformation. The Agricultural Revolution, approximately 10,000 years ago, marked a pivotal transition from nomadic lifestyles to settled agricultural societies. This shift not only augmented food production but also fostered the rise of complex social structures, governance systems, and economic dependencies. The subsequent Industrial Revolution further accelerated technological development, introducing machinery that radically altered production capacities and labor dynamics.

Technological evolution, particularly in the recent centuries, has also been characterized by exponential growth rates. The advent of the Internet and digital technologies has redefined communication, information dissemination, and social interaction. This interconnectedness has generated vast repositories of knowledge, yet it has also engendered vulnerabilities—such as information overload and digital divides—that threaten the coherence of human societal systems.

Consciousness: A Parallel Evolution

Concurrently, the evolution of consciousness has been intricately linked to these technological advancements. Human consciousness, defined as the state of being aware of and able to think about one’s own existence, thoughts, and surroundings, has been shaped significantly by environmental stimuli and cultural contexts.

Theories such as the Extended Mind thesis, proposed by philosophers Andy Clark and David Chalmers, suggest that tools and technologies serve as extensions of the mind, enhancing cognitive capabilities. This perspective offers insight into how humanity's reliance on technology has led to altered states of consciousness, where the boundaries of the self become increasingly blurred with external tools and networks. The very act of engaging with technology alters cognitive processes, leading to new forms of thought and perception.

The Interplay between Technology and Consciousness

The convergence of technology and consciousness can be observed in the phenomenon of social media. Platforms such as Facebook and Twitter have not only transformed communication but have also influenced collective consciousness. The mechanisms of sharing, liking, and commenting create a feedback loop where individual consciousness is shaped by the collective—an evolving hive mind where information is rapidly disseminated and filtered through social validation. The implications extend beyond mere interaction; they touch upon identity formation, social hierarchies, and even mental health, as individuals grapple with the pressures of public perception and digital performance.

Moreover, the integration of artificial intelligence into daily life introduces a new layer to this dynamic. As AI systems become embedded in decision-making processes, ethical considerations emerge regarding agency and autonomy. The cognitive load on individuals is altered as they cede certain aspects of decision-making to algorithms, raising questions about the authenticity of human agency when augmented by machine learning. This relationship is not merely transactional; it suggests a co-evolution where technology alters human cognition as much as human cognition shapes technology.

Structural Dependencies and Bottlenecks

The interdependence of technology and consciousness presents structural weaknesses within human systems. The rapid pace of technological change often outstrips the capacity of human consciousness to adapt, leading to cognitive dissonance and societal fragmentation. The phenomenon of echo chambers, where individuals are exposed primarily to information that reinforces their existing beliefs, exemplifies this bottleneck. As technology amplifies voices within these chambers, the collective consciousness becomes polarized, undermining social cohesion and complicating governance structures.

Furthermore, the dependency on technology raises questions about resilience. The reliance on digital infrastructures renders human societies vulnerable to disruptions—whether from cyberattacks, technological failures, or social unrest. This fragility highlights a paradox: while technology promises to enhance human capabilities, it simultaneously exposes them to systemic risks that could jeopardize their existence.
